Alfred Baker 1841–1886 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 25 Apr 1841

Birth Location: Shoreditch, Middlesex, England

Death Date: 7th September 1886

Death Location: Warragul, Victoria, Australia

Father: Thomas Baker

Mother: Jane Hendy

Spouse(s): Isabella Lees

Children(s): Alexander Baker, Ernest Baker

The story of Alfred Baker began in 1841 in Shoreditch, Middlesex, England. In 1851, Alfred Baker resided in Bromley St Leonard, Middlesex, England. Alfred Baker married Isabella Lees, and had children including Alexander Sydney Baker, Ernest Alfred Alf Baker. Alfred Baker passed away in 1886 in Warragul, Victoria, Australia.
